An Additional Superintendent of Police (ASP) was killed while several other police personnel and officers sustained injuries in a pressure IED blast triggered by Naxals in Chhattisgarh’s Sukma district on Monday, News18 reported.
In the incident that took place near Dondra on the Konta-Erabor road, ASP Akash Rao Giripunje was critically injured and later succumbed to his injuries.

Two other security personnel, including the DSP and Inspector, were also injured in the incident. They are reportedly out of danger, the report added. Konta Town Inspector and Sub-Divisional Police Officer were also injured in the blast and are currently undergoing treatment.
As per the report, the ASP was on foot patrol duty in the area to prevent any Naxalite incident ahead of Bharat Bandh called by the CPI (Maoist) on June 10.
